SORT LAUNDRY AND LOAD WASHER
Sort laundry
by fabric type, soil [eve[, color and load size,
as needed.
Open the door and load selected items into the
washer.
TURN ON THE WASHER
Press the POWER button to turn ON the washer. The lights
around the cycle selector knob win illuminate
and a chime
win sound.
SELECT A CYCLE
Turn the cycle selector knob in either direction
to seIect the
desired cycle. The preset Wash Temperature, Spin Speed, Soil
Level, and Option
settings for that cycle win be shown.

SELECT CYCLE MODIFIERS
Default
settings for the selected
cycle can now be changed
if
desired.
Use the cycle
modifier
buttons.
NOTE:
To protect
your fabrics,
not all modifiers
are available
on all cycles.
SELECT CYCLE OPTIONS
Cycle options can be added using the option buttons.
NOTE: To protect your fabrics, not all modifi ers are available
on aN cycles. Cycle options can also be added by using the
option buttons.
NOTE: Not aIt options are available
on aN cycIes. A diff erent
chime will sound and the LED will not come on if the selection
is not allowed.
ADD DETERGENT
Add High-Effl
ciency (HE) detergent
to the detergent
dispenser drawer.
For proper wash performance,
always
measure the detergent
using the mesure provided
by the
detergent
manufacturer.
BEGIN CYCLE
Press the START/PAUSE button to begin the cycle. The door
will lock, and the washer will briefly tumble the load without
Water to measure its weight. Once the weight of the load is
measured, the washer will begin the selected wash cycle.
Pressing the START/PAUSE button will pause the cycle and
the door win unlock. Press the START/PAUSE button again to
resume the wash cycle.
